    Charlie Harris Releases New Single: “Yesteryear”

    Henno KrugerBy Henno Kruger3 Mins Read Music Videos 14 ViewsFebruary 12, 2026
    Share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Copy Link

    South African singer-songwriter Charlie Harris returns with his latest single, “Yesteryear” – a warm and heartfelt reflection on nostalgia, family and the quiet moments that shape who we become.

    Rooted in memory and emotion, the track captures the longing for togetherness and the lasting comfort of shared history. It’s a song that leans into the past without losing sight of the present.

    Charlie Harris

    A Song Inspired by Reflection

    “Yesteryear” was born from a period of introspection, as Charlie Harris found himself revisiting memories of his younger years – holidays surrounded by family and friends, and laughter echoing through familiar spaces.

    “It’s about calling out and hoping someone hears you,” he explains. “Those moments from the past were so full of love and togetherness, and I never want to lose that feeling. This song is for everyone I loved back then and everyone I love now – because the joy of yesterday never really leaves us.”

    The single channels that universal experience of looking back and realising how deeply those memories still live within us.

    An Intimate, Acoustic Sound

    Musically, “Yesteryear” embraces Charlie’s signature acoustic-driven style. Gentle instrumentation supports emotive, unguarded vocals, creating a sound that feels intimate and familiar.

    The result is a track that plays like a quiet moment of reflection – the sonic equivalent of flipping through old photographs and rediscovering the emotions attached to them.

    Continuing a Journey of Reflection

    The single follows the introspective path laid by “All I Have Is Now,” which encouraged listeners to slow down and embrace the present, and “Give Me Love,” a tender exploration of connection.

    Where those releases looked inward and forward, “Yesteryear” turns its gaze toward the past, honouring the people and experiences that continue to anchor and define us.

    Charlie Harris’ Career is Built on Honest Storytelling

    Born and raised in Johannesburg, Charlie Harris began his musical journey at 13 after learning a few chords from his uncle and receiving his first guitar soon after. Music quickly became a space for freedom and self-expression.

    Over the years, he has been involved in several band projects, including Hemisphere and Radio Unfriendly, before forming Keep Guessing Charlie with close friends.

    With two albums released – Digital Dust (Side A) and Digital Dust (Side B) – Charlie has built a reputation for honest songwriting and emotional depth. His work blends classic acoustic sensibilities with contemporary introspection, resonating with listeners who value authenticity over spectacle.

    A Reminder That Yesterday Still Matters

    “Yesteryear” stands as a gentle reminder that while time moves forward, the love, laughter and connection of the past remain with us.

    In its quiet way, the song suggests that growing up doesn’t mean letting go – it means carrying those moments with us, allowing them to shape the present in meaningful ways.
